For its Annecy Production Studio, Ubisoft is looking for a  3D Programmer   to join a team in charge of developing a AAA game and participate in the upcoming Ubisoft blockbuster.

The 3D programmer will be responsible for the features that render the 3D game universe (e.g. render architecture, texture, SFX, lighting, etc.).

The main and routine tasks of the 3D programmer are to:

* Compile and understand the 3D intentions of the project, document development needs and assess technical feasibility;

* Analyze existing 3D functions in the engine and see if they are in line with intentions;

* Suggest improvements whenever necessary by designing and implementing new systems;

* Collaborate with the graphic design technical director to establish constraints and communicate the technical possibilities of the various 3D features to the artistic teams;

* Suggest innovations inspired by other from the games industry;

* Validate and verify whether the newly developed and integrated 3D systems meet the specific and general project intentions and are coherent with existing code;

* Optimize whenever necessary;

* Support the 3D features and systems designed for production;

* Determine and correct the 3D bugs identified by other working units and the quality control team;

* Document the work to transfer knowledge and enable users (other working units) to understand how to use the 3D systems and functions;

* Carry out all other related tasks.

Bachelor’s degree in computer science, computer engineering or equivalent training;, with a minimum 2 years’ experience in 3D programming, ideally in the video game sector, or any other relevant experience

* Master the C++language

* Advanced knowledge of the following API 3D in C++ (DirectX11, DirectX12, Vulkan) and Shader languages (HLSL, GLSL, etc.)

* Knowledge of best practices in software design and memory compromises vs CPU vs GPU in a multiplatform context

* Solid knowledge of linear algebra and mathematics linked to 3D

* Knowledge of multiplatforms and tools an asset

* Knowledge of the production tools used y the artists (3DSMax/Maya, Photoshop, etc.)
